Dishwashers Salary in District of Columbia
The median pay for a dishwashers in District of Columbia is $37,540/year ($18.05/hour), per BLS data. The range runs from $37K at the entry level to $49K for experienced workers.

How much do dishwashers make in District of Columbia?
The median is $37,540 a year - that works out to about $18.05 an hour. The range is wide: entry-level workers start around $36,540, and experienced dishwashers can clear $48,990. These are BLS numbers, based on employer-reported data, not self-reported surveys.
Is $38K enough to live in District of Columbia?
On that salary, you'd take home roughly $2,586/month after taxes. A 2-bedroom in this state rents for about $2,246/month (median of metro areas), which eats 86.9% of your paycheck. That's above the 30% rule of thumb - housing will be a stretch at the median salary, though you can manage with roommates or a smaller place.
